Overview

Working in an electronics warehouse in Den Bosch involves handling, sorting, and managing electronic products and components. This type of job is suitable for EU workers from Romania, Poland, Hungary, Spain, Portugal, Bulgaria, Lithuania, and Greece who are looking for stable employment in the logistics sector. Employers in this field often seek individuals who are reliable, detail-oriented, and able to work in a team environment.

What to Expect

In an electronics warehouse, you can expect to work in a fast-paced environment with a focus on efficiency and accuracy. Typical working hours may range from early morning to late evening, including shifts that can vary weekly. The job can be physically demanding, requiring lifting, standing for long periods, and operating machinery. Safety protocols are strictly followed to ensure a secure working environment.

Typical tasks include receiving shipments, sorting products, packing orders, and managing inventory. You may also operate machinery like forklifts.

Most electronics warehouse jobs do not require prior experience, but familiarity with warehouse operations can be an advantage.

Working hours can vary, typically ranging from 36 to 40 hours per week, including possible shifts during evenings and weekends.

You will need a valid ID, a BSN (Burger Service Nummer), health insurance, and possibly a work permit, depending on your nationality.

In 2026, salaries typically range from €14.71 to €18.00 per hour, depending on experience and the employer.

Yes, many companies offer permanent contracts after a probationary period, especially if you demonstrate reliability and skill.
